Sometimes, the truth isn’t enough when you’re dealing with rumours. After all, simply saying you didn’t do it, isn’t going to help your case against others. However, Chinese actor-singer Zhou Jia (周杰) seems to have created his own way of dealing with plausible rumours.
The former “My Fair Princess (還珠格格)” actor retired from acting to invest in agriculture. He recently returned to the entertainment scene. Unfortunately, his return was greeted with slander by a netizen. In an effort to dispel the rumours, Zhou Jia came up with a rather unconventional response.
Recently, a netizen accused the 51-year-old actor of some rather spicy things. The netizen claimed to be an ex-girlfriend. She said Zhou Jia broke up with her because she refused to take birth control pills. Apparently, he had given her an ultimatum about the issue and her choice led to them breaking up. “After abandoning me, you turned around and found another woman,” she allegedly said. “You take your relationships so seriously, so dirty.”
On top of that, the netizen claimed that Zhou Jia needed young women, preferably in their twenties, to be with him. She also alleged that the actor had taken a mortgage and was having financial problems. As proof, she released his private photos and their chat history. Her announcement caught netizens’ attention and discussions about it broke out.
In the midst of everything, Zhou Jia decided to respond. He left a message on his Weibo on 11th December, stating: “My friend said that as long as I admit I am gay then I can prove my innocence. Well, I actually am (gay).” Netizens were quick to comment on the matter. Some were sceptical, of course. “Wild guess; no one wants to get (together) with you,” one said. “I’m gay, of course someone wants to,” Zhou Jia smartly replied. Another netizen stated, “You (as a) gay look a bit steely and straight.” The actor fired back with: “Annoying, annoying, annoying. It’s so obvious, can’t you tell?”
He had several supporters. However, the majority, aside from the sceptics, weren’t happy with his response. Many felt he should not have responded at all. Others felt it was a joke gone bad. Some just found it confusing! Still, the actor wasn’t one to sit idly by. He addressed the new issue on 12th December with the same aplomb he’d been showing.
Zhou Jia listed out the accusations that had been thrown at him, such as being a bad person, being impotent and having French kissed someone. He also added the names he had been called, such as “animal”, “dog shit” and “scumbag”. The actor stated he admitted to everything they had accused him of. “May I ask what else (do) you want?” he said sarcastically. A netizen left a comment on this post saying, “You really have thick skin.” Needless to say, the actor had apparently reached the end of his rope by then, given his succinct, “F**k you.”
We’re not exactly sure if Zhou Jia managed to resolve his issue, but that was certainly one way to come out of the closet! If anything, the actor did, at least, manage to redirect people’s attention.
Both posts have already been taken down, but it’s doubtful it will be erased from people’s minds. Well, only the future knows what’s in store for the now openly gay actor.
